About the Author
My grandparents came to Arizona by horse drawn wagon in 1908. They settled outside of Douglas Arizona, which is right on the Mexican border. My father was a geologist and mining engineer. I attribute my deep affinity for the mystery of the Earth to the fact that as a small child I had the opportunity to accompany my father on numerous expeditions to exotic destinations in the desert in order that he might inspect various mines and mining claims.
During these adventures I developed a sensitivity to the presence of the energetic qualities of the land. In other words; I learned how to feel the energies of the Earth, which are always present, but often overlooked. My evolution from the natural simplicity of a child to that of a well-known writer and researcher in the field of metaphysics was largely catalyzed by my discovery, at the age 17, of the writings of Carlos Castaneda.
During my late teens and 20's, I moved back and forth between Arizona and California many times, ultimately, I bought a house in Cottonwood Arizona in 1988. Shortly after that I began my first book Sedona Power Spot, Vortex, and Medicine Wheel Guide. It was first published February 17, 1991, two days after operation desert storm. I am happy to report that this book has become the standard reference for understanding the Vortex phenomenon in Sedona.
